2. Priest’s garments
Clothes define a person’s status. There is a reason why the Levite priests wore separate clothes. It differentiated their status and position from the world. However, regardless of the countless numbers of priests, the problems of sin and Satan were not solved. Therefore, God sent Jesus Christ, the true priest, who resolved all sins and the problem of Satan. Those who believe in Christ wear different clothes. They have a distinct status as the royal priesthood (1Peter 2:9) that differentiates them from others.
